Anemia hotspots in Mozambique linked to water, pregnancy, and weight
Anemia is a big health problem for women in Mozambique. A study looked at why this happens and found that factors like bad drinking water, pregnancy, and being underweight make anemia more likely. But using contraception and being obese can actually help protect against anemia in some areas. The study used data from a big survey and found that certain regions in Mozambique have higher rates of anemia than others. To help fight anemia, it's important to improve access to clean water, provide good maternal health services, and make sure people have the right nutrition.
